I see that VR often catches a dropped signal, but what does that mean? Should the train have immediately stopped? Thanks for any help explaining it to me.
@jerrysinclair37712 жыл бұрын
@@aaronneumeyer5572 'Dropped signal' is an old railroad slang because it looks like the signal fell or dropped. In reality it is called an aspect change. The change from green to red occurs AFTER the engine(s) have passed the signal and occupy the next block. The engineer never sees this because he has passed the signal and he is looking ahead for any possible hazards and of course the next signal one or two miles down the line. By the way, 'dropped signal' is not a universal slang...but is referred to in North American railroads.
